Nedum Onuoha has raved about Leeds United winger Crysencio Summerville on BBC Sport for his goal against Bournemouth at Elland Road in the Premier League on Saturday.
Leeds have got the better of Bournemouth 4-3 at home in the league this afternoon.
Dutch winger Summerville scored the winner in the 84th minute of the match.
It was a superb goal, and former Manchester City defender Onuoha was impressed.
Praise for Crysencio Summerville for Leeds United goal v Bournemouth
Onuoha said: “What a comeback! You can see that Summerville making the run behind and thinking is the ball going to him?
“He gets dispatched, goes one v one and slams the ball into the top corner. Absolutely incredible finish. Feels like this is what Leeds deserve.”

Crysencio Summerville has been doing well for Leeds United in recent times, and the winger played well against Bournemouth at Elland Road in the Premier League today.
The 21-year-old’s goal was brilliant, and he will be pleased to have scored the winner.
The Netherlands Under-21 international winger is progressing nicely at Leeds under head coach Jesse Marsch.
The Leeds no. 10 has made three starts and six substitute appearances in the Premier League for the West Yorkshire club so far this season.
Summerville has scored three goals in those matches.
Now, of course, the Dutchman is not going to start week in and week out for Leeds, but if he continues to score goals and make an impact, then he could become a regular in the coming months.
